JQuery: اتصال به یک صفحه وب

فهرست مطالب:

JQuery: اتصال به یک صفحه وب
JQuery: اتصال به یک صفحه وب
Anonim

jQuery یک کتابخانه جاوا اسکریپت است که بر نحوه کارکردن فناوری‌های HTML، جاوا اسکریپت و CSS تمرکز دارد.

چه کاری jQuery می تواند انجام دهد

کتابخانه می تواند با فهرست وظایف زیر کار کند:

  • می تواند مطلقاً به هر عنصری از مدل شی صفحه (DOM) دسترسی داشته باشد و دستکاری های پیچیده با آنها انجام دهد؛
  • پشتیبانی از مدیریت رویداد؛
  • قابلیت برای جلوه های گرافیکی و انیمیشن های مختلف وجود دارد؛
  • کار ساده شده با فناوری بارگذاری پویا AJAX (یک ویژگی بسیار مهم و بسیار مفید، اما اکنون در مورد آن نیست)؛
  • jQuery تعداد زیادی پلاگین مخصوص به خود دارد که وظیفه اصلی آنها پیاده سازی رابط های گرافیکی کاربر و تعامل کاربر با آنهاست.

نسخه های فشرده و غیر فشرده کتابخانه

توسعه دهندگان چندین گزینه برای اسکریپت دارند - یکی فشرده است، دیگری نه. نسخه کامل برای استفاده در مرحله کدنویسی و اشکال زدایی (تست) برنامه های وب بسیار راحت است. از طرف دیگر، نسخه حداقلی مزایای مفید کمی در هنگام اشکال زدایی خواهد داشت، اما بسیار سریعتر بارگذاری می شود و فضای کمتری را اشغال می کند. بنابراین یک نسخه فشرده از jQuery مناسب استاز قبل در پروژه تمام شده استفاده کنید، زیرا باعث صرفه جویی در ترافیک سرور و فضای دیسک می شود.

اتصال جی کوئری
اتصال جی کوئری

نحوه انتخاب نسخه مناسب jQuery

امروزه چندین جریان اصلی در jQuery وجود دارد - شاخه های 1.x، 2.x و 3.x. تفاوت قابل توجه آنها این است که از نسخه دوم، هر گونه پشتیبانی از مرورگرهای قدیمی مانند مرورگر شرکت مایکروسافت - اینترنت اکسپلورر، تا نسخه هشتم متوقف شد.

این تصمیم باعث شد تا حجم فیزیکی داده‌های کتابخانه به میزان ده درصد کاهش یابد و کار آن اندکی بهینه شود. با این حال، هنوز کامپیوترهای خانگی و شرکتی در جهان وجود دارند که اینترنت اکسپلورر قدیمی به عنوان مرورگر اصلی در آنها نصب شده است، اگرچه درصد این کاربران در سراسر جهان از 3 درصد فراتر نمی رود. بنابراین، این به شما بستگی دارد که از پلتفرم قدیمی پشتیبانی کنید یا نه.

توسعه دهندگان jQuery به اصول سازگاری نسخه ها به عقب پایبند هستند. این بدان معناست که کد نوشته شده برای نسخه 1.7 کتابخانه با نسخه 1.8 نیز کار می کند. اما گاهی اوقات شرکت توسعه‌دهنده توابعی را از jQuery حذف می‌کند که مفید نیستند، بنابراین اگر می‌خواهید به‌روزرسانی کنید، بهتر است اسناد نسخه جدید را دوباره بخوانید.

در سال ۲۰۱۶، شعبه جدیدی از jQuery منتشر شد. این نسخه 3.0 بود که حتی سریعتر و سبکتر از نسخه های قدیمی شد. هک‌ها در نهایت از آن حذف شدند تا برخی از عملکردها را در مرورگرهای قدیمی پیاده‌سازی کنند، که به کتابخانه اجازه می‌دهد به عنوان یک ابزار توسعه مدرن و قدرتمند قرار گیرد.

اگر شماپروژه از قبل به برخی از کتابخانه ها متصل شده است، سپس ابتدا هزینه های نیروی کار برای ارتقاء را برآورد کنید. اگر مزیت نسخه جدید ارزشش را دارد، با خیال راحت شروع به کار کنید. برای همه توسعه دهندگانی که به تازگی شروع به استفاده از ابزار در پروژه های خود کرده اند، توصیه می شود مستقیماً با آخرین نسخه ها شروع کنند.

چگونه با jQuery شروع کنیم

اولین قدم اتصال جی کوئری است. برای انجام این کار، باید کتابخانه را مستقیماً از منبع توسعه دهنده jquery.com یا از یک آینه دانلود کنید و کتابخانه را روی وب سرور خود قرار دهید.

حالا اجازه دهید اتصال واقعی jQuery را به صفحه وب انجام دهیم. اتصال اسکریپت های مختلف در زبان نشانه گذاری فرامتن توسط تگ اسکریپت انجام می شود. jQuery را با کد زیر وصل کنید:

اتصال جی کوئری
اتصال جی کوئری

این گزینه برای اتصال آفلاین خوب است، اما راه‌های زیادی برای استفاده از سرور وجود دارد.

اتصال jQuery با استفاده از خدمات ابری

Google سرویس کتابخانه های میزبانی شده را ارائه می دهد که با استفاده از آن هر کسی می تواند یک چارچوب یا کتابخانه محبوب را به برنامه وب خود متصل کند. برای اتصال jQuery از طریق Google Cloud Storage، از رشته ای که با نسخه انتخابی مطابقت دارد در الگوی زیر استفاده کنید:

نحوه گنجاندن کتابخانه جی کوئری
نحوه گنجاندن کتابخانه جی کوئری

اعداد در ستون نسخه ها با شماره نسخه ای که برای نصب و کار بیشتر با آن در دسترس است مطابقت دارد. برای اتصال هر یک از نسخه های متوسط، فقط آن را کپی کنیدعدد عددی در رشته اتصال به جای اعداد مشخص شده در مثال.

شما همیشه می توانید لیست نسخه های فعلی را در: مشاهده کنید

developers.google.com/speed/libraries/jquery

اگر به هر دلیلی به Google اعتماد ندارید، اما همچنان می خواهید بدانید چگونه کتابخانه jQuery را از یک سرور مورد اعتماد شخص ثالث دریافت کنید، از مخزن مایکروسافت استفاده کنید.

شامل کتابخانه جی کوئری
شامل کتابخانه جی کوئری

jQuery یکی از بهترین ابزارها برای ایجاد آسان انیمیشن در صفحات وب است. هنگامی که به قدرت این ابزار پی بردید، بسیار خوشحال خواهید شد که شروع به یادگیری چنین کتابخانه ای کرده اید.

شکاکان در بین دانشجویان و توسعه دهندگان معتقدند که بهتر است همه چیز را با استفاده از یک زبان برنامه نویسی خالص و بدون استفاده از کتابخانه های شخص ثالث پیاده سازی کنید. اما باید بدانید که فایل jQuery فقط سی و دو کیلوبایت است و اگر اسکریپت را از طریق Google وارد کنید به احتمال زیاد در حافظه پنهان مرورگر کاربر شما قرار دارد. بنابراین از یادگیری ابزارهایی که زندگی را برای یک توسعه دهنده آسان تر می کند نترسید. پس از همه، ما کتابخانه jQuery را برای این کار گنجانده ایم - تا چرخ را دوباره اختراع نکنیم.

توصیه شده: